What do Maynard Ferguson, Santana, Barbra Streisand, Frank Zappa, Tool, Jeff Beck, and Rush all have in common? Their music was all played and discussed in our very first Tuesday Night Vinyl.
Tuesday Night Vinyl Recap
Thank you to everyone who turned out for the inaugural Tuesday Night Vinyl. As one guest said, “this is like book club, but for records.” Exactly right. That was precisely the intent and as soon as our group gathered at the studio tonight, we all felt that.
This program is about connectedness. It is about how music that has meant something personal to us can be communicated to other people.

GrooveLIVE Season 2!
One of the primary functions of grooveKSQ is to support independent musicians and artists. We are pleased to announce the first two performers of the second season grooveLIVE, which is a high quality video stream you can watch right here at the website, on our Facebook page, or on our YouTube channel.
Season Two of grooveLIVE will occur on the following dates:
January 27, 2020
February 10, 2020
February 24, 2020
March 10, 2020
March 22, 2020
April 6, 2020
A couple of adjustments from the pilot episodes we ran last year: the livestreams are moved to Monday nights, right before Monday Night Football, with a 7:30pm start and a 30 minute program. You’ll notice that the second event in March falls on Sunday, March 22, 2020. There will be much more detail about that event as we get closer. Expect an announcement right after Christmas 2019.
